V70R Drive Shaft Problems V70-XC70

I have a '98 V70R AWD with 130K miles and yesterday my wife called me at work to tell me the car was making loud tinging sounds from somewhere under the drivers seat. This morning, I put the car up on ramps to take a look. I moved the tubular drive shafts ahead of and after the splined joint (center support?) and isolated the sound to the forward shaft after the transmission differential housing. When I rotated it back and forth it made a loud tinging sound. The same sound my wife describe whiling driving.

Does anyone have any thoughts on what the problem might be? Would it be okay to drive the car to the repair shop or should I have a flatbed pick it up?

V70R Drive Shaft Problems V70-XC70

Good news. The rhythmic clanking noise was the front drive shaft universal joint.

V70R Drive Shaft Problems V70-XC70

I have a V70 AWD (125k) which started out making a weird whirring noise at high speed, then progressively worse clunking until there was a definity rotational clunk which could be heard half a block away. Went through a lot of non-diagnostics looking for the noise before actually wiggling the drive shaft, and viola, there it was. (Dealer didn't find it, two indy's did, and neither of them thought it was a big deal, but that I should repair it sometime (fcp groton drive shaft $860). In the meantime, it has stopped rattling - one mechanic suggested that it's due to the rubber shrinking in the colder weather, and since it's been such a warm winter to date . . .
In conclusion, isn't the the worst that would happen is that I'd suddenly have a front wheel drive instead of AWD? I've heard that some people just take the darn thing out.
